Understanding the Basics of the Mines Game
At its most fundamental level, the mines game presents a grid – typically composed of squares – concealing a predetermined number of mines. Players begin by placing a bet and then clicking on squares within the grid. If a player successfully clicks on a square that doesn’t contain a mine, the payout increases, often multiplying the initial stake. The game continues until either a mine is revealed, ending the round and forfeiting the bet, or the player chooses to ‘cash out’, securing the accumulated winnings.
The number of mines hidden within the grid is usually customizable, allowing players to adjust the risk level. A higher mine density translates to greater potential rewards, but also a significantly elevated risk of triggering a mine. This customization is a key element of the game’s appeal, catering to players with varying risk appetites. The resulting dynamic is a captivating experience that requires a subtle balance between boldness and caution.

The Psychological Aspects of the Game
The mines game taps into several fundamental psychological principles. The intermittent reinforcement – the unpredictable nature of rewards – creates a compelling addictive loop. The anticipation of potential winnings, coupled with the adrenaline rush of narrowly avoiding mines, triggers the release of dopamine, a neurotransmitter associated with pleasure and reward. This contributes to the game’s highly engaging nature, keeping players coming back for more.
The illusion of control is another key psychological factor. While the game is ultimately based on chance, players often feel as though their decisions and strategies are influencing the outcome, even when they may not be. This perception of control can lead to overconfidence and risky behavior. It is vital to remain aware of these psychological tendencies and avoid allowing them to cloud judgment.
